Insulating Glass
If you’re involved in the manufacture of sealed insulating glass
for residential and commercial glazing applications, you know how important
it is to prevent fogging inside your window units and to halt permanent
staining of the glass. Fortunately, you can count on UOP’s line
of molecular sieves for effective ways to adsorb water or organic solvents
within your windows’ “dead air” space.
UOP has developed several high capacity MOLSIV adsorbent formulations to remove
and tightly trap water and solvents from this air space, thereby maximizing
the life of your units. We have beaded products for systems employing hollow
metal spacers, and powder forms where an organic matrix is used to create the
spacing between the glass surfaces.
When your products require both water and organic vapor removal, look to UOP’s
combinations of 3A and 13X molecular sieves for peak adsorption efficiency.
These combinations limit the potential for glass deflection (resulting from
adsorption of air or other gases filling the insulating space), which can lead
to increased unit stresses and loss of insulating properties. Our products
within this category include MOLSIV 3A and 13X activated powders, as well as
MOLSIV 4000 beads, a homogenous mixture of 3A and 13X.
If you manufacture solvent-free systems in which only water removal is required,
count on UOP’s 3A based products for superior water adsorption with the
lowest potential for glass deflection due to air adsorption. For this application,
your best options are MOLSIV 2000 and XL-8 beads, and 3A activated powder.
